I already read this news a few weeks ago. This boycott is going on around the 
world. In the Netherlands all Pathe cinemas are banning the movie. Apparently 
there's a deal that there's supposed to be a minimum period of 4 months between 
theater release and DVD release. Theaters are now complaining, but I did not 
hear them complain when This is It! played until December and it's also now 
being released on DVD within 3 months. I don't understand all the fuzz. Disney 
+ Tim Burton + Johnny Depp + 3D Movie + Alice in Wonderland = guaranteed 
success!
Last year theaters in the Netherlands made more money than they did in the past 
15 years. Boohoo, damn that recession. Boohoo, damn Piracy. Avatar alone is 
already proofing cinema is not dead although there's piracy and a recession. 
Produce great movies and you will get excellent box-office numbers.

  Just wondering if this is going on in the USA also...

  Odean cinemas are banning Alice in Wonderland a few others are now following 
their footsteps.

  Disney are basically only giving them a few weeks to show the movie before 
it's being released on DVD. They claim it it will reduce piracy but all this is 
doing is spoiling the cinema experience.

  Seems odd that Disney are doing this. I know that DVD's make more money than 
movie theatres but this is ridiculous.
